An emerging X–ray technology applied in dento–maxillofacial imaging is cone beam computerized tomography (CBCT). CBCT provides 3 –dimensional imaging of more complex and more accurate imaging when compared to conventional and digital radiology.  Accurate information required for diagnosis, treatment planning, and post–treatment evaluation can be gathered with CBCT system available with small field of view images and at low dose. When it comes to pediatric dentistry radiation dose should be considered. Although radiation dose from CBCT is low in comparison to conventional Computerized tomography(CT), radiation risk to patient should be assessed and quantified. This article provides an overview of applications of CBCT in pediatric dentistry.
